Gold IRA Insights covers the classic Roth-vs-Traditional decision, which applies whether or not gold enters the picture: a Traditional IRA (including a Traditional Gold IRA) gets taxed on withdrawal, while a Roth version is funded with after-tax dollars but grows and comes out tax-free in retirement, provided the account meets the five-year holding rule and you’re 59½. Both versions can hold IRS-approved gold under IRC Section 408(m); the tax treatment is the real difference. Here’s the breakdown.
